What is DTCC?

DTCC stands for the Depository Trust & Clearing Corporation. It is a financial services company that provides clearing, settlement, and information services for a wide range of securities transactions. DTCC helps to ensure the smooth and secure transfer of securities and payments between buyers and sellers, reducing risks and increasing efficiency in the financial markets. The organization acts as a central clearinghouse and depository for various financial instruments, including equities, corporate and municipal bonds, and derivatives.

Summary / objective of position:
The Operations Trading Associate will primarily be responsible for managing the equity trading desk related to stock execution and mutual fund processing, post trade processing, security classification, and security setup. Associate will primarily work with outside brokers and custodians, along with the firm’s Portfolio Management and Operations teams to ensure trades are executed and settled correctly in a timely manner. Operations Trading Associate will also assist the Equity Trading Manager and Operations Manager on special projects. The position presents a great opportunity to gain experience and knowledge at a growing and dynamic investment advisory firm.
Essential functions of position:
Equity Trading Desk – Manage the equity trading blotter within the Eze trading platform, by taking ownership, , reviewing, merging, and placing orders, for various equity securities including stocks, ETFs, options, and preferred stocks, with the appropriate brokers in a timely and efficient manner. Monitor the limit blotter and execute orders when limits hit. Process daily mutual fund files with outside custodians. Review and apply daily account restrictions for trading purposes. Work with the firm’s Portfolio Managers on trading related inquiries, special trading instructions, and resolving any trade issues in a timely manner.
Post Trade Processing – Manage the post trade process to ensure that trades executed by the Equity and Fixed Income traders are allocated and booked correctly by monitoring the Central Trade Manager (CTM) blotter, affirming DTC confirms in the Trade Suite system, keeping the ALERT system up-to-date with current delivery instructions, and work as a liaison between brokers and custodians to resolve settlement issues.
Other Responsibilities – Include security setups, sector classifications, managing trading compliance alerts, end-of-day allocations, pricing securities, work on internal Help Desk tickets and other responsibilities assigned by the Equity Trading Manager.
Associate will be expected to work within a team-based environment, where duties and responsibilities alternate with another team member on regular basis to keep each associate’s skills up-to-date and give adequate coverage when a member is out.
